The famous Pearl of Bengal has disappeared and our girl detective, Agatha Mystery, is on the case. The young Agatha is 12-years-old, has an amazing memory, and when she grows up she wants to be a famous mystery writer! She and her cousin, Larry, a student at Eye International, the world-renowned detective school, team up and travel the world to solve mysteries.
